COMPLETED. The war for the freedom of humans was a long, treacherous era for Prythian. But the aftermath, when Courts attempted to rebuild within their newly drawn lines, proved to be just as uncharted and dangerous. Courts that had fought on opposite sides of the war found themselves at odds, and powerful offspring began to lay claim to their parent's thrones. As such, a new alliance is formed between the young half Fae half Illyrian High Lord of the Night Court, and Helion, High Lord of the Day court. It is through this alliance that Helion's bastard daughter, Elora, meets Azriel, the High Lord of the Night Court's Shadowsinger. Azriel was infamous, and feared by all who beheld him. But not Elora, as she found that perhaps they were not so unlike.
